About Cohasset, Minnesota

Cohasset is a locality in Itasca County, Minnesota, United States. It has a population of approximately 2,703. The population density is 37.7 people per km². Cohasset is located at 47.2636°N, 93.6202°W. It observes the Central Time (America/Chicago) timezone. ZIP code: 55721.

Cohasset rests on a land that exhales the deep, quiet breath of the north woods. It lies 78.6 miles west-north-west of Duluth, MN (from Duluth, MN: bearing 296°T), and is situated 4.6 miles west-north-west of Grand Rapids. The story of Cohasset is one of resourceful people drawn to the bounty of this northern expanse. Logging once echoed through these forests, the timber industry a vital artery that pulsed through early life here, shaping the very contours of the land and the lives of its inhabitants. Today, the economy leans more towards the quiet hum of tourism and the enduring connection to the natural world, with lakeside cabins and the promise of abundant fishing drawing visitors who seek solace and adventure.
